Who won Garcia vs Easter Jr?
Mikey Garcia beat Robert Easter Jr by unanimous decision in their 12 round contest on Saturday 28th July 2018 at Staples Center in LA.
The scorecards were announced as 118-109, 117-110, 116-111 in favor of winner Mikey Garcia.
The fight was scheduled to take place over 12 rounds in the Lightweight division, which meant the weight limit was 135 pounds (9.6 stone or 61.2 KG).
This contest was for the unified lightweight championship of the world, with the IBF & WBC belts on the line.
The undercard featured the clash of Ortiz vs Cojanu.
Garcia vs Easter Jr stats
Mikey Garcia stepped into the ring with an undefeated record of 38 wins, zero loses and 0 draws, 30 of those wins coming by the way of knock out.
Robert Easter Jr made his way to the ring with an unblemished record of 21 wins and 0 draws, with 14 of those by knock out.
The stats suggested Garcia had advantage in power over Easter Jr, with a 79% knock out percentage over Easter Jr's 67%.
Mikey Garcia was the older man by 3 years, at 35 years old.
Easter Jr had a height advantage of 4 inches over Garcia. That also extended to a 8-inch reach advantage.
Both Mikey Garcia & Robert Easter Jr fought out of an orthodox stance.
Garcia was the more experienced professional fighter, having had 17 more fights, and made his debut in 2006, 6 years and 3 months earlier than Easter Jr, whose first professional fight was in 2012. He had fought 96 more professional rounds, 248 to Easter Jr's 152.
Garcia vs Easter Jr form
Garcia had won 5 of his most recent fights, stopping 2 of them, going the distance 3 times.
In his last fight leading up to this contest, he had defeated Sergey Lipinets on 10th March 2018 by unanimous decision in their IBF World Junior Welterweight championship fight at Alamodome, Texas, United States.
Previous to that, he had defeated Adrien Broner on 29th July 2017 by unanimous decision in their 12 round contest at Barclays Center, New York.
Going into that contest, he had beat Dejan Zlaticanin on 28th January 2017 by knockout in the 3rd round in their WBC World Lightweight championship fight at MGM Grand, Las Vegas.
Before that, he had won against Elio Rojas on 30th July 2016 by technical knockout in the 5th round at Barclays Center, New York.
He had beat Juan Carlos Burgos on 25th January 2014 by unanimous decision in their WBO World Junior Lightweight championship fight at Madison Square Garden, New York.
Easter Jr had won 5 of his most recent fights, stopping 1 of them, going the distance 4 times.
In his last fight before this contest, he had defeated Javier Fortuna on 20th January 2018 by split decision in their IBF World Lightweight championship fight at Barclays Center, New York, United States.
Previous to that, he had defeated Denis Shafikov on 30th June 2017 by unanimous decision in their IBF World Lightweight championship fight at Huntington Center, Toledo.
Going into that contest, he had won against Luis Cruz on 10th February 2017 by unanimous decision in their IBF World Lightweight championship fight at Huntington Center, Toledo.
Before that, he had defeated Richard Commey on 9th September 2016 by split decision in their IBF World Lightweight championship fight at Santander Arena, Reading.
He had beat Argenis Mendez on 1st April 2016 by technical knockout in the 5th round at DC Armory, Washington.

What time did Garcia vs Easter Jr start?
The fighters were expected to ringwalk at around 11:00 PM EST / 8:00 PM PST at Staples Center, LA, United States, which was around 4:00 AM BST in the UK.
Who broadcast Garcia vs Easter Jr?
Garcia vs Easter Jr was broadcast on ShowTime in the US.
What were the odds on Garcia vs Easter Jr?
Mikey Garcia was a 2/25 (-1200) favourite going into the contest, while Robert Easter Jr made his way into the ring at 6/1 (+600) with oddsmakers.
